What they do

A Maintenance Helper or Assistant assists maintenance mechanics. Repairs and maintains equipment and machines, such as cars or heating systems. May assemble or adjust machines as directed by a head mechanic.

Job Description

Responsibilities:
Under the direct supervision of the Maintenance Director, our Maintenance Assistant oversees the Community safety program and maintains a secure resident home and working environment in compliance with policy and regulations Sustains a preventative maintenance program to maintain proper functioning of all Community equipment, plumbing, electrical, and HVAC systems Completes all maintenance requests, both scheduled and emergency, quickly and efficiently Performs exterior maintenance duties Performs fire and disaster drill activities with residents and team members Engages with residents in a compassionate and impactful manner, cultivating a warm and supportive environment where the values of love, compassion, and dignity are reflected in every interaction
Qualifications:
High school graduate or GED equivalent required Experience in HVAC systems and/or electrical required Prior Senior living experience desired Demonstrates exceptional interpersonal, written and verbal communication skills
